java中HashSet对象内的元素的hashCode值不能变化

因为不管是HashMap(或HashTable,还是HashSet),key值是以hashCode值存进去的,加入key值变了,将无法从集合内删除对象,导致内存溢出。

posted @ 2019-06-16 12:30  ppjj  阅读(695)  评论(0编辑  收藏  举报